The SECO 17016376 is a single-end cobalt square end mill designed for material removal in demanding machining applications. Built from M42 cobalt high-speed steel and finished with a TiCN (Titanium Carbonitride) coating, it delivers improved hardness and wear resistance over standard HSS tooling. The cutting geometry features 2 spiral flutes with a 30-degree helix angle, right-hand cut, and right-hand flute direction. The centercutting design allows plunge entry into the workpiece. With a 9/16-inch diameter, 1-1/8-inch length of cut, and 1/2-inch shank, this is a short-series mill suited for general-purpose milling where rigidity and precision matter. Machinists and tool-and-die shops are the primary users.
This end mill is rated for use on steel, stainless steel, cast iron, and high-temperature alloys, covering ISO material codes P, M, K, and S. It is well suited for slot milling, peripheral milling, and light plunge operations in CNC machining centers and manual mills. The short flute length and rigid shank geometry reduce deflection in harder workpiece materials. The TiCN coating provides a low-friction surface that extends tool life in abrasive cutting conditions. Designed as a Series SP205 short-series cobalt square end mill for machining steel, stainless steel, cast iron, and high-temperature alloys with a 1/2-inch straight shank. Fits any mill spindle or toolholder accepting a 1/2-inch shank diameter.
Installation is performed by machinists using a standard collet chuck or end mill holder rated for 1/2-inch shank tooling. Ensure the spindle and toolholder are clean and free of chips before seating the shank. Confirm runout does not exceed the 0.0010-inch TIR maximum before beginning a cut. Always engage machine guarding and follow shop safety procedures when changing or running cutting tools.
